Is Canva Free for Resume?

Canva is an online graphic design platform that helps users create stunning visuals for various applications, including resumes. It offers hundreds of templates, which allow users to quickly create a professional-looking resume in no time. The best part about Canva is that it’s free to use for all, making it a great choice for those on a budget who don’t have the money to invest in expensive software like Adobe Photoshop or Illustrator. But the question remains: Is Canva really free for resume creation?

The answer is yes! Canva is absolutely free and easy to use, so anyone can create a professional-looking resume with no cost. The platform offers hundreds of templates, which you can customize in any way you want. You can choose from different font styles, sizes, colors, backgrounds and more. Plus, Canva also offers a wide selection of ready-made designs which you can use as-is or make your own changes to fit your needs.

In addition to being free and easy to use, Canva also provides some great features that make resume creation even easier. For instance, it allows users to sync their data with LinkedIn profiles or other sources so they don’t have to manually input all their information every time they need to update their resume. It also provides tools like drag and drop functionality, text boxes and frames that allow users to easily add images or graphics into their resumes with just a few clicks.
